On Fri, Jul 29, 2005 at 11:24:13AM +0530, Lakshminarayanan Radhakrishnan wrote:
> Can u please highlight the important fixes added upto  2.6.6 ?

There have been several security fixes for those using rsync as a
daemon.  The memory use has decreased dramatically compared with the
2.5.x series, and some options such as --hard-link are *much* more
efficient.  Some new options I particularly like: --delete-during
(--del), --itemize-changes (-i), the --filter functionality, and
--partial-dir (I use have the RSYNC_PARTIAL_DIR environment variable set
for improved safety when using -P).  Large files are handled much more
efficiently, exclude patterns are less buggy, batch files actually work
right, etc.  etc.  Lots of other really useful features and bug-fixes
too numerous to mention here.

> In samba site, anywhere mentioned about what patches given for each
> release ?

There's a link on the main page to the NEWS and OLDNEWS files:

    http://rsync.samba.org/ftp/rsync/NEWS
    http://rsync.samba.org/ftp/rsync/OLDNEWS

They mention LOTS of changes, though, so you may want to skim mainly
the SECURITY FIXES, ENHANCEMENTS, and BUG FIXES sections.
